Output 12691c376750d31bc47a85977d73901bc828bd60b466ba4c21810f19cf502f69:6

value
108663629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f40b6bf5efc5fc2277140a7a823ec35c06be589 OP_EQUAL
address
3DHsGJaUGUVyw8hifbSZgG7AUoYEMTvoKV
transaction
12691c376750d31bc47a85977d73901bc828bd60b466ba4c21810f19cf502f69
spent
true